#NO-GO: The city of Paris is going to sue Fox News over remarks made about ‘no-go zones’ in the city.

#MISSOURI: A five-year-old boy accidentally shot and killed his nine-month-old baby brother after finding a gun in his house.

#JAPAN: Islamic State militants threatened to kill two Japanese hostages unless a $200 million ransom is paid.

#STOP IT: Pope Francis said good Catholics no longer have to breed “like rabbits”, though he still isn’t encouraging use of contraception.

#YEMEN: Rebels have seized the president’s palace and violence has escalated.
